Transportation Research Record 1795 examines case studies on cost-effective preventive maintenance; the physicochemical analysis of bituminous crack sealants; the performance evaluation of a ten-year joint resealing project; the performance of Louisiana's Chip and Seal Microsurfacing Program; the phenomena and conditions in bridge decks that confound ground-penetrating radar data analysis; the durability of concrete crack repair systems; the cost of maintenance, repair, and rehabilitation of Florida bridges; and the testing of a calcium nitrate corrosion inhibitor in concrete. The papers contained in this volume were among those presented at the 81th Annual Meeting of the Transportation Research Board in January 2002.
